Chicago Bears vs Atlanta Falcons NFL Picks, NFL Odds & NFL Predictions: The rested Bears find themselves in the Peach State this weekend for a Sunday Night Football showdown with NFC rival Atlanta. The Falcons are coming off a big road win against the Forty-Niners and now have their sights set on another potential playoff foe. Kickoff in this big-time showdown is set for 8:20pm ET at the Georgia Dome in Atlanta (NBC). NFL Picks at BetUS.com have the Bears listed as a +3.5 against the spread road dog. Bears Breakdown: Overall Record 3-1 Key to the game: Crowd Control"It's a loud environment," quarterback Jay Cutler said. "Sunday night football, it will be even louder so we've got to protect the ball. They're a good defense...we've got to play our best ball." Falcons Breakdown: Overall Record 3-1 Key to the game: Pass Offense Atlanta has been one of the more prolific passing offenses in the league this season, and they will need to keep that up against the Bears. Chicago plays stout against the run, but the Bears are giving up an average of 226 yards per game through the air. The Falcons will need to keep Chicago honest with the run, but they can expect to do their heavy hitting with Matt Ryan and the passing attack.
